Hello guys, i have 1 ssd whihc is disk C, and where windows 8.1 is installed, and hdd disk G, where i install all my games in program files folder. What i want is to buy 1 new 2tb ssd, and then copy OS from ssd C and files from hdd G in one new ssd. Is there a way to do it? So all the games can work like the same.. Just dont want to reinstall os or something like that, cuz i got to much to lose in settings in programs and stuff

You can clone the os over and resize the partition, then you can straight up copy and paste your game files from the other hard drive to the new ssd. You'll need to tell Steam/Origin/whatever where the games are but you shouldn't need to reinstall them.

If you don't want to respecify the location of your games, you can make another partition besides the OS on the SSD and assign it the letter G. You can copy the files over to that partition and it would function the same as when you were using the separate drives.
